What is the purpose of statistics?

The purpose of statistics is to collect, organize, analyze, interpret, and present data.

What is a statistical population?

A statistical population is the entire group of people or objects that is the subject of a statistical study.

What is the difference between an experimental study and an observational study?

An experimental study involves manipulating the system under study and taking measurements to determine the effect of the manipulation, while an observational study does not involve experimental manipulation.

What are the two main statistical methods used in data analysis?

The two main statistical methods used in data analysis are descriptive statistics, which summarize data using indexes such as the mean or standard deviation, and inferential statistics, which draw conclusions from data subject to random variation.

What is representative sampling and why is it important in statistics?

Representative sampling ensures that inferences and conclusions drawn from a sample can reasonably extend to the entire population. It is important in statistics to make generalizations about the population based on the sample data.
